What are Real False Lashes?
Real false lashes are pre-made lash strips that are designed to enhance your natural lashes. They're called 'real' because they're made from actual hair, usually from cows or horses. The lashes are attached to a thin, flexible band that makes application a breeze.

How to Apply Real False Lashes
Prep Your Lashes
Before application, gently remove any makeup from your lash line. Then, use a lash curler to curl your natural lashes. This will help the false lashes adhere better and create a more natural look.
Measure and Trim
Measure the false lash against your eye, trimming any excess length if needed. Remember, it's better to trim too little than too much – you can always trim more, but you can't add length back!
Apply the Glue
Apply a thin layer of lash glue along the band of the false lash. Wait a few seconds to let the glue get tacky – this will give you a better grip.
Place the Lash
Using tweezers or an applicator, carefully place the false lash as close to your natural lash line as possible. Look down into a mirror to ensure you're placing it correctly.
Press and Blink
Gently press the false lash into place with your fingertips, blinking a few times to help the lash adhere to your natural lashes.
Caring for Your Real False Lashes
Removing Them
At the end of the night, use an oil-based makeup remover to gently remove the false lashes. Pull gently from the outer corner, working your way in.
Cleaning Them
Clean your false lashes with a cotton swab dipped in makeup remover, then let them air dry completely before storing.
Storing Them
Store your false lashes in their original case or a lash box to keep them clean and tangle-free.
